
Stray Kids left a strong impression with the music video teaser for their new song 'DIVINE.' Stray Kids will release SKZ IT TAPE 'DO IT' on November 21. Prior to this, JYP Entertainment has been sequentially releasing comeback teaser content through their official SNS channels. On the 16th, they released the music video teaser for 'DIVINE,' one of the double title tracks. The teaser features Stray Kids having fun with demons, inspired by the protagonist Jeong Woo-chi from the classic novel 'Jeong Woo-chi.' The scenes are expressed as if they jumped out of a canvas, with eye-catching modern reinterpretations of items like ink wash painting animations and the folk tale of the tiger and the five peaks of the sun and moon. Additionally, the visual beauty harmonizes with traditional aesthetics. The new album series SKZ IT TAPE 'DO IT' includes the double title tracks 'Do It' and 'DIVINE,' along with the songs 'Holiday,' 'Photobook,' and 'Do It (Festival Version),' totaling five tracks. The producing team 3RACHA, consisting of Bang Chan, Changbin, and Han, participated in the production of all songs, incorporating the group's unique style. Stray Kids' SKZ IT TAPE 'DO IT' will be officially released on November 21 at 2 PM (midnight Eastern Time).
